The international encounter of the temporarily professed sisters took place from 2nd June to 1st July 2008 in France. We gathered together in Paris from Chile, Cameroon and Madagascar to spend these four weeks together.
It was a time when we got to know each other a little better, with the variety and diversity which characterises our different cultures. We were helped to deepen the history of our Congregation in the very country where each one of the seven founding Congregations has its roots. This became more real as we visited some of the foundation places. We were also enabled to relate the history of the Congregations to the changing history of France.
Three days of recollection in the silence and beautiful surroundings of our house at Epernon, St Thomas' Priory bound us together at a deeper level especially in what is the essence of our common call and mission.
Before we parted company a festive evening of dances, songs and laughter was spent with the community and friends of Epernon - a beautiful illustration of the colours of our different countries. |
